آموزش ارث بری در سی شارپ


آموزش ارث بری در سی شارپ
براي خريد اين درس نياز است وارد سايت شويد. در صورت نداشتن حساب کاربري عضو شويد.

آموزش ارث بری (inheritance) در زبان برنامه نویسی C#:

در این جلسه، با یکی از ارزش های بزرگ شی گرایی، وراثت (inheritance) آشنا می شوید. از آنجا که درک این موضوع برای مبتدیان کمی دشوار می باشد ما در این آموزش ویدئویی آن را به زبان ساده و گویا با راحت ترین و قابل فهم ترین مثال بیان می کنیم.

 

 در جلسات قبل هر کلاسی که تعریف کردیم، کلاس های مجزا از هم و بدون وابستگی بودند. اما از این به بعد می خواهیم کلاس ها را به یکدیگر ربط دهیم و از آن ها استفاده کنیم به شکل والد و فرزند.

 به کمک وراثت در سی شارپ یک کلاس می تواند خصوصیات و متد های یک کلاس دیگر را به ارث ببرد، مانند والد و فرزند، که فرزند خصوصیاتی از جمله چهره، گروه خونی و ... را به ارث میبرد.

 گاهی در یک محیط عملیاتی چند موجودیت یا کلاس داریم که دارای صفت های مشترک هستند،  که می توانیم در یک کلاس صفت های مشترکشان را تعریف می کنیم به عبارتی کلاس والد است و هر کدام از کلاس های صفت های خاص خود را دارند که این کلاس ها می توانند صفت های کلاس والد را به ارث ببرند در واقع به این کلاس ها، کلاس های فرزند می گویند.

 

 

برای یادگیری این مبحث مثال ها و نکته های متعددی را در فایل ویدئویی آورده ایم که با خریدن این درس و مشاهده ویدئو ها به طور کامل به این مبحث مسلط خواهید شد.

 

 

 

امیدواریم که این آموزش، برای شما دوستان درسمنی عزیز مفید باشد،

درصورت سوال و یا مشکل می توانید به انجمن برنامه نویسان سی شارپ مراجعه کنید. پیشنهادات و انتقادات خود را در بخش نظرات برای ما ارسال کنید.

 


نظر بدهید نشانی ایمیل شما منتشر نخواهد شد .
برای ارسال نظر نیاز است وارد سایت شوید. در صورت نداشتن حساب کاربری عضو شوید.


مشخصات دوره


مدرس دوره : مهدی عباسی
تعداد جلسات 36 جلسه
مدت زمان 1119 دقیقه
حجم دوره 4/58 گیگابایت
سطح مهارت مقدماتی تا متوسط
وضعیت دوره پایان یافته
تعداد دانشجویان 1178
: میانگین امتیاز

رایگان
برای دسترسی به این دوره وارد یا عضو شوید.
مهدی عباسی

مهدی عباسی


درباره مدرس :

مهدی عباسی هستم، مسلط به حداقل ۲۰ زبان مطرح برنامه نویسی به صورت پیشرفته، مدیر عامل شرکت آریا نرم افزار و بنیانگذار آکادمی آنلاین درسمن، مسلط به تدریس دروس تخصصی کاردانی و کارشناسی کامپیوتر، پایگاه داده ... ده ها، برنامه نویسی پیشرفته، مبانی برنامه نویسی، مباحث ویژه طراحی وب و ....
بیشتر بدانید